The Real World Difficulties for Efficient Testing

The greater complexness of programs and their increasing competition have created the need for more efficient and comprehensive examining. The most important requirements for any item success is to release the right item at the perfect time. Top high quality programs are expected to be developed and provided within restricted plans and restricted sources. This requirement of providing more with less has brought forward numerous challenges for handling the high company’s application application through functional examining.

Functional Testing catches user specifications and helps to ensure that the application meets those specifications. The importance of functional examining improves with the increase in the application complexness.

Challenges of Efficient Testing

The entire functional examining life-cycle is restricted with numerous challenges and technical restrictions. This leads to the ingredients of strategies and guidelines to get rid of these problems. Efficient examining starts with collecting high quality specifications and goes through design and growth assessments, performance of the assessments into further examining the item problems.

Here we look further into places associated with each stage in application functional examining.

Gathering analyze requirements:

– Definition of obvious and finish analyze requirements
– Manage changes into the specifications.

Planning the Test:

– Efficient holes in analyze plans
– Difficulty faced by the group while examining large analyze programs.

Strategizing Tests:

– Usage of the available resources
– The best possible analyze coverage
– Cover various analyze configurations
– Deliver within deadline

Execution of tests:

– Battle due to mismatch between analyze programs and needed functionality
– Time taken for setting up analyze environment and the comprehensive set of assisting options.
– Time taken for solving repeating problems.
– Preventing problems in the running places.
– Re-planning the initial plan.

Managing the defects:

– Imperfect and uncertain confirming on the problems.
– Review inconsistency for the same problem by the different associates.
– Inappropriate intensity or priority projects to reviews.
– Owner mistakes causing into tagging a problem as not a problem.
– Inappropriate procedure applied for problem confirmation.
– Insufficient monitoring of the problems.
– Inappropriate monitoring of a problem impacting the overall performance of the application item.

Reporting of the Test Results:

– Comprehensive reviews needed for analyze outcomes which should be easily easy to understand by the each person associated with the project.
– Needed use a finish position report feature sensible.
– Should offer a specific problem sensible data.
– The report should ease the making decisions for the item Go/No Go.

Collection of Test Analytics, Research and Improvement:

– Need for the procedure to look at the high quality and efficiency of the examining process and further identify the places of enhancement.
– Need for calculating the program and the item.

It is not practically possible to analyze an item fully. The analyze protection for an item depends on the examining capability of the implemented group. Due to the application complications, high quality specifications have also become huge. These require comprehensive application and components options to be set up. Providing this settings protection is also an equal challenge. Additionally, it needs to be considered that the efforts and sources at hand will always be restricted. Considering all the facts an effective analyze management needs to be designed.